How Meporva 400 Tablet works:
Meporva 400mg tablets contain an antibiotic that inhibits the bacterial enzyme DNA gyrase. This inhibition blocks bacterial cell division and repair, leading to bacterial cell death.
SAFETY ADVICE
AlcoholSAFE
Meporva 400 Tablet consumption alongside alcohol does not produce adverse reactions.
PregnancyCONSULT YOUR DOCTOR
Use of Meporva 400 Tablet during pregnancy may pose risks. While human research is scarce, animal studies indicate potential harm to the unborn child. A physician will assess the potential advantages against any risks prior to prescribing. Seek medical advice before taking this medication.
Breast feedingCONSULT YOUR DOCTOR
The use of Meporva 400 Tablet while breastfeeding is likely inadvisable. Available human data indicates potential transfer of the medication into breast milk, posing a possible risk to the infant.
DrivingUNSAFE
Driving may be impaired by Meporva 400 Tablet side effects. These effects can include dizziness, lightheadedness, brief visual disturbances, or temporary fainting episodes, all potentially impacting safe driving.
KidneySAFE IF PRESCRIBED
Meporva 400 Tablets can be used by individuals with kidney conditions without altering the prescribed dosage. Nevertheless, patients with pre-existing kidney disease should disclose this information to their physician.
LiverCAUTION
Patients with severe hepatic impairment should use Meporva 400 Tablet cautiously; dosage modification may be necessary. Physician consultation is advised.
What if you forget to take Meporva 400 Tablet :
Should you forget a Meporva 400 Tablet dose, take it immediately. But if your next dose is nearly due, omit the missed one and resume your usual dosing pattern. Never take a double dose.
